Quick Cheese Soup: A Comforting and Delicious Meal

This quick cheese soup is a warm, comforting dish that’s perfect for when you need a hearty meal in a hurry. With simple ingredients like potatoes, carrots, onions, and a generous amount of melted cheese, this soup is both rich and satisfying. Ingredients

  • 4 potatoes: Provides a hearty base and creamy texture when cooked.
  • 1 onion: Adds sweetness and depth of flavor.
  • 1 carrot: Contributes a subtle sweetness and vibrant color.
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il: For sautéing the vegetables.
  • 15 grams butter: Adds richness and enhances the flavor of the soup.
  • 2 cloves garlic: Infuses the soup with a warm, aromatic flavor.
  • 1 liter vegetable or chicken broth: The liquid base of the soup, providing depth and savory flavor.
  • 200 grams grated cheese (cheddar, emmental, or a cheese blend): Melts into the soup, creating a creamy, cheesy texture.
  • Salt, to taste: To enhance the flavors.
  • Pepper, to taste: Adds a touch of heat and depth.
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(optional, for garnish): Adds a fresh, bright finish.

Instructions

1. Prepare the Vegetables:

  • Peel and cut the potatoes into small pieces.
  • Finely chop the onion.
  • Peel and grate the carrot.
  • Mince the garlic.

2. Sauté the Vegetables:

  • In a large pot, combine olive oil and butter, heating them over medium heat.
  • Toss in the chopped onion and cook for 3-4 minutes, or until it becomes tender and clear.
  • Add the grated carrot and minced garlic, and cook for another 2 minutes until fragrant.

3. Cook the Potatoes:

  • Toss the diced potatoes into the pot and mix them with the sautéed vegetables.
  • Pour in the vegetable or chicken broth and bring everything to a boil.
  • Reduce the heat to low, cover the pot, and simmer for about 15-20 minutes, or until the potatoes are tender.

4. Add the Cheese:

  • Once the potatoes are cooked, use a potato masher or an immersion blender to slightly mash the potatoes in the soup, creating a thicker texture while still leaving some chunks for a rustic feel.
  • Gradually add the grated cheese to the soup, stirring constantly until the cheese is fully melted and the soup is creamy.

5. Serve and Garnish:

  • Ladle the hot soup into bowls.
  • Garnish with fresh chopped parsley if desired, adding a fresh and vibrant touch.
